#15bd06 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#15bd06 is composed of 8.2% red, 74.1%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.8%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 115.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 38.2%. #15bd06 color hex could be obtained by blending #2aff0c with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#15bd06 color description : Strong lime green.

#15bd06 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#15bd06 has RGB values of R:21, G:189,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 1424646.

Hex triplet 15bd06 #15bd06
RGB Decimal 21, 189, 6 rgb(21,189,6)
RGB Percent 8.2, 74.1, 2.4 rgb(8.2%,74.1%,2.4%)
CMYK 89, 0, 97, 26
HSL 115.1°, 93.8, 38.2 hsl(115.1,93.8%,38.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 115.1°, 96.8, 74.1
Web Safe 00cc00 #00cc00
CIE-LAB 66.95, -67.575, 65.854
XYZ 18.539, 36.566, 6.253
xyY 0.302, 0.596, 36.566
CIE-LCH 66.95, 94.356, 135.739
CIE-LUV 66.95, -62.012, 81.343
Hunter-Lab 60.47, -51.097, 36.198
Binary 00010101, 10111101, 00000110

Shades and Tints of #15bd06

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021201 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#15bd06

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606360 is the less saturated color, while #15bd06 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#15bd06 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#767676 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#638460 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#bca800 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#d09f32 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#60b3c0 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7faf02 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#8caa22 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#44b67c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
